OASIS Christmas Shop – Saturday, December 8th and Sunday, December 9th

Get your Christmas spirit in gear by helping at the annual OASIS Christmas Shop. This All-Volunteer event gives our pantry clients the opportunity to ‘shop’ for donated Christmas toys and winter wear for their family.  Clients sign-up at the Food Pantry to participate in the event which takes place over the weekend of December 7th at Hope Lutheran Family Center located at 1795 Old Hwy. 94, St. Charles, MO.

Volunteers over the age of 18 are still needed to work the following dates:

  • Saturday, December 8th – 7:30am until noon
    Volunteers will be trained then work the Christmas Shop greeting shoppers, helping select toys, carrying bags, and creating a positive experience for shoppers (pantry clients).
  • Sunday, December 9th – 12:30pm until 4:30pm
    Volunteers will be trained, work the Christmas Shop, then pack up toys, and clean up.

Pantry Drivers – Ongoing

O.A.S.I.S is seeking two people to do the Wednesday morning Schnucks/Dierbergs food donation pick-up.  This entails pick-up and delivery of food items from the designated grocery stores and takes about 3 hours (approximately 8am to 11am) using an O.A.S.I.S. cargo van. Drivers must have valid car insurance, a valid driver’s license, and the ability to lift at least 30 pounds unassisted. Thrift Store Workers – Ongoing

The O.A.S.I.S Thrift Store is up and running but is short on volunteers. Donated items sold at the Thrift Store is one way the pantry raises funds to purchase food and personal care items for distribution at the pantry. Birthday Bag Mission – Ongoing

The Food Pantry is seeking someone interested in helping with the Birthday Bag mission at O.A.S.I.S. This mission assembles a birthday kit for clients whose children will have a birthday during the month. The bags include a cake mix, frosting and a book or DVD for school-aged children.
